APESMA aims to bring members together, to provide an effective voice for professionals in the workplace, and to help develop our professions and industries. We are a not-for-profit association run for and governed by our members.


Working Together

With APESMA, professionals can join together to influence their organisations and shape their work environments.
We assist members to become workplace representatives and provide training and support in these key roles.

Promoting

APESMA promotes professional needs and the professional contribution in the workplace. This ensures that members have access to worthwhile, rewarding and sustainable careers and that organisations make the best decisions based upon professional advice.
We support ongoing professional development and recognition. We help to drive the introduction and upkeep of relevant professional standards and competencies.
APESMA is promoting your professions as an attractive career to the next generation of graduates. We provide information about the workplace to students in Universities across Australia and have over 20,000 student members.

Developing

APESMA’s input is highly regarded in many influential forums. APESMA representatives are involved in a range of external committees and projects.
We are continually developing innovative programs to aid professional careers. These range from partnerships with government and industry for skills renewal and retraining, to APESMA member services.

Influencing

We are active in influencing government and industry, through official and personal channels. Policy areas where we have been most active include industrial relations, education and training, research and innovation, investment in infrastructure and professional regulation.
Our presence in the media is growing. APESMA comments on the issues that affect our members and their professions, and strives for coverage that advances their professional interests.
